Calls is a mystery thriller analog animated miniseries created by Fede lvarez. The show is based on a French television series of the same name created by Timothe Hochet. The series is a co-production between Apple TV+ and French network Canal+, the latter being the production company behind the original French version. It premiered on March 19, 2021, on Apple TV+.[1]

Told through a series of interconnected phone conversations, these conversations chronicle the mysterious story of a group of strangers whose lives are thrown into disarray in the lead-up to an apocalyptic event.

On June 21, 2018, it was reported that Apple had given the production a series order for a first season consisting of ten episodes. The series, an English-language adaptation of original French series Calls, was created by original series creator Timothe Hochet. The show is a co-production between Apple TV+ and French network Canal+. Alongside Apple's series order announcement, it was confirmed that Apple had acquired the rights to the existing season of the original French series.[2][4][5]

A couple, Sara in New York, Tim in L.A. have a phone call. Their long distance relationship is not working. Tim has met someone else, and is trying to break up with Sara. She is terrified that someone is trying to break into the house. The issues escalate when Sara calls 911 because the intruder does not look human. Things escalate when Tim and his new partner Camila, also have an encounter that cannot easily be explained. (The calls take place on December 30th)

A young man finds out that his girlfriend is pregnant, and he leaves to go on a drive to sort out his head. But as he drives, phone call after phone call tells him he's been driving a lot longer than he thinks. (The calls for him take place on Feb 9th near Phoenix, Arizona.)

A phone call from a neighbor changes the lives of Patrick and his wife Alexis, as they get caught up in a robbery, affair and betrayal. But who can really be trusted? (The phone calls take place on March 2nd in Pasadena.)

A divorcing couple, and the wife's sister, call back and forth. Each sister demands the attention of someone else, until ultimately painful truths are revealed. (The calls take place on March 29th, San Francisco.)

Two grieving siblings have heard about mysterious phone calls that can cross time, and want to try and reach their mother in the past. But they didn't pay attention to how those Internet stories warned about the dangers of changing the past. (The calls take place on November 9th, between Ribbonwood and San Diego)

After the fate of Flight 908, a pair of physicists are trying desperately to figure out how and why phone calls are crossing the dimensional barrier. And it may involve an abandoned project from 1978. (The calls take place on December 30th, Azusa, Ithaca.)

Use the calls engagement API to log and manage calls on CRM records and on the calls index page. You can log calls either in HubSpot or through the calls API. Below, learn the basic methods of managing calls through the API. To view all available endpoints and their requirements, click the Endpoints tab at the top of this article.

The ID of the object to which the call's associated record belongs (e.g., specifies if the record is a contact or company). This will be the object of the recipient for OUTBOUND calls, or the object of the dialer for INBOUND calls.

The direction of the call from the perspective of the HubSpot user. If the user is the call recipient, the direction should be set to INBOUND. If the user initiated the call, the direction should be set to OUTBOUND.

The outcome of the call. To set the call disposition, you need to use the internal GUID value. If your account has set up custom call outcomes, you can find their disposition GUIDs using this API. The default HubSpot outcome labels and their internal values are:

A unique identifier to indicate the association type between the call and the other object. The ID can be represented numerically or in snake case (e.g., call_to_contact). You can retrieve the value through the associations API.

For recorded calls and voicemails, a recording is stored in the hs_call_recording_url property. If your account has access to inbound calling, to differentiate between calls that were completed and recorded vs. inbound calls with a voicemail, include the following properties in your request: hs_call_status and hs_call_has_voicemail.

If a call has a voicemail, the hs_call_status value will be missed, and the hs_call_has_voicemail value will be true. The hs_call_has_voicemail value will be false for an inbound call where no voicemail was left, or null if the call has a status other than missed.

You can pin a call on a record so it remains on the top of the record's timeline. The call must already be associated with the record prior to pinning, and you an only pin one activity per record. To pin a call, include the call's id in the hs_pinned_engagement_id field when creating or updating a record via the object APIs. The Department of Corrections (DOC) supports incarcerated individuals maintaining ties with family, friends, and the community, and per DOC 450.200 Telephone Use by Incarcerated Individuals (pdf), will provide incarcerated individuals access to telephones and reasonably priced telephone services.

All incarcerated individuals are assigned a Personal Identification Number (PIN). Incarcerated individuals must enter their PIN to initiate a phone call and are responsible for all calls made using their assigned PIN. Friends and family do not need to know an incarcerated individual's PIN to fund a phone account.

Incarcerated individuals with hearing and/or speech disabilities, and those incarcerated individuals who wish to communicate with parties who have such disabilities, will have access to a Telecommunications Device for the Deaf (TDD).

Incarcerated individuals are provided access to telephones subject to limitations and restrictions to ensure the security and orderly management of the facility, and to protect the public. Incarcerated individuals may not use the telephone system to continue or initiate criminal activity.

Prisons use a monitoring/recording system to enhance security, increase incarcerated individual and public safety, and reduce criminal activity or activity that could threaten the orderly operation of the facility. The DOC protects incarcerated individual's constitutional rights by providing for unmonitored legal phone calls made to a telephone number recognized by the applicable state's bar association. See DOC 450.200 Telephone Use by Incarcerated Individuals (pdf) for details.

Per DOC 450.200 Telephone Use by Incarcerated Individuals (pdf), the Superintendent/designee of the prison facility where an individual is incarcerated may permit the incarcerated individual to use a non-PIN State Controlled Area Network (SCAN) telephone line under compelling circumstances, such as family emergencies. These calls will be placed and supervised by employees.

The 2024 EDF Work Programme addresses 32 call topics in total, structured along 6 thematic calls for proposals, 2 non-thematic calls for proposals and 2 actions in support of the Alliance for Defence Medical Countermeasures.

It will support projects in critical defence domains, such as countering hypersonic missiles, developing a broad range of unmanned vehicles in the air and on the ground, as well as secure space communication. It also prepares the ground for next generation defence systems, such as helicopters and mid-size cargo aircraft.

EUDIS will continue to fund the organisation of annual defence hackathons, as well as business coaching for SME beneficiaries and the Defence Equity Facility under InvestEU. The novelty for 2024 is the foreseen funding for a EUDIS Business Accelerator and Matchmaking with investors (call for tender expected to be published in spring 2024).

Applying for funding requires the creation of a consortium consisting of at least three Member States or associated countries (currently only Norway). Calls for disruptive technologies allow smaller consortia (at least two entities from two Member States or associated countries).

They should not be controlled by a non-associated third country, with exceptions possible through approved guarantees. Entities from non-associated third countries can participate, but under conditions ensuring the EU security and defence interests, without receiving EDF funding.

CMS National Stakeholder Calls provide an opportunity for CMS to share information related to policies or initiatives with the stakeholder community at large. National Stakeholder calls are intended for all stakeholders who interact with CMS programs, policies, or initiatives or work with providers, beneficiaries, or consumers who rely on CMS services.

Medicaid & CHIP All State Calls share information to the states and territories regarding a range of flexibilities available during this public health emergency including section 1135 waivers , flexibilities for section 1915(c) Home and Community-Based Waivers, and other guidance released.
